This auction is for FOUR (4) NEW Door Bumpers (these attach to the door) – These are brand new, never used!  Show Quality!

 

Very Flexible, will help with rattles and/or Door alignment.

 

*Replaces the GM part number 20376243 & 4564974

 

GM used the same Door Bumper for many many years, so they fit several applications:

  • 1949 - 1957 Chevrolet, Buicks, Pontiacs, Olsmobile (replaces GM # 4564974)
  • 1978 - 2004 GM (replaces GM # 20376243)

New Ford Kuga arrives in the guise of 2012 / 2013 Ford Escape

The 2013 Ford Escape arrives - the 2012 Ford Kuga The reveal of the new Ford Escape ahead of the Los Angeles Auto Show this week may not have the Kuga badge on its boot, but it is – bar a few tweaks and engine changes – just what we’ll see in Europe as the 2012 Ford Kuga. Based on the European-designed Ford Vertrek concept, the Ford Escape replaces the old-fashioned North American escape with a very European take on a compact SUV, but one that benefits from much more room to accommodate average Americans. The Ford Kuga / Escape is the next instalment in Ford’s plan to unify its models around the world.
